General Description

The MOC8111/ MOC8112 is an optocoupler consisting of a gallium arsenide infrared emitting diode optically coupled to a silicon planar phototransistor detector in a plastic plug-in DIP 6 pin package.

The coupling device is suitable for signal transmission between two electrically separated circuits.
